The rapid experimental technique for determination of equilibrium water content in porous media in contact with ice (unfrozen water) or gas hydrates (nonclathrated water) is developed. The method is based on experimental data of pore water potential via water content on the samples and some thermodynamic calculations. The water potential of soil (or artificial porous media) is determined by device WP4–T, developed by Decagon Devices (USA) at the range of positive in Celsius temperatures (above and below room temperature). The main purpose of the report is to demonstrate how the experimental data on water potential Ψ (as well as a difference of chemical potential between pore water and bulk water) via water content in porous media (natural soils and artificial media) may be used for thermodynamic calculations of unfrozen and nonclathrated water content as a function of pressure and temperature. As for unfrozen water content in porous media the method is work in a wide range of negative on Celsius temperatures between zero and minus 30 °C. As for nonclathrated water content the method is work both at negative and positive temperatures.
